<h2><a name="introduction" id=
"introduction"></a>Introduction</h2>
<p>Python 2.5 introduces a new <tt>Py_ssize_t</tt> typedef and
two related macros (<a href=
"http://www.python.org/dev/peps/pep-0353/">PEP 353</a>). The
<tt>&lt;boost/python/ssize_t.hpp&gt;</tt> header imports these
definitions into the <tt>boost::python</tt> namespace as
<tt>ssize_t</tt>, <tt>ssize_t_max</tt>, and <tt>ssize_t_min</tt>.
Appropriate definitions are provided for backward compatibility
with previous Python versions.</p>
<h2><a name="typedefs" id="typedefs"></a>Typedefs</h2>Imports
<tt>Py_ssize_t</tt> into the <tt>boost::python</tt> namespace if
available, or provides an appropriate typedef for backward
compatibility:
<pre>
#if PY_VERSION_HEX &gt;= 0x02050000
typedef Py_ssize_t ssize_t;
#else
typedef int ssize_t;
#endif
</pre>
<h2><a name="constants" id="constants"></a>Constants</h2>Imports
<tt>PY_SSIZE_T_MAX</tt> and <tt>PY_SSIZE_T_MIN</tt> as constants
into the <tt>boost::python</tt> namespace if available, or
provides appropriate constants for backward compatibility:
<pre>
#if PY_VERSION_HEX &gt;= 0x02050000
ssize_t const ssize_t_max = PY_SSIZE_T_MAX;
ssize_t const ssize_t_min = PY_SSIZE_T_MIN;
#else
ssize_t const ssize_t_max = INT_MAX;
ssize_t const ssize_t_min = INT_MIN;
#endif
</pre>
